What It Is
Medical definition: Tiredness is feeling low energy or sleepy.
Why GLP-1s may cause it: Zepbound can reduce intake and shift sleep patterns, which may cause fatigue.

Warning Signs
Normal: Low energy after dosing days.
Concerning: Fatigue that interrupts work or chores.
When to call your doctor: Tiredness lasting more than 2 weeks.
When to go to the ER: Severe weakness or fainting.
- Red flag checklist: Fainting, Severe weakness, Shortness of breath.
Prevention
- Sleep on a consistent schedule.
- Eat regular meals.
- Stay hydrated.
- Keep light daily activity.
Treatment
- Take short rests as needed.
- Recheck nutrition and fluids.
- Avoid heavy workouts when very tired.
- Discuss persistent fatigue with your clinician.
